The Shiploader weighs approx. 350 Ton, and will be transported on 74 wheels from its current site, down the runway, and to a barge in Pat Bay. Once the Shiploader has been positioned on the barge, it will be lashed to the barge for sea transport to Port McNeil. At Port McNeil a large barge crane called the Arctic Tuk will hoist the Shiploader onto a support apparatus errected ocean side to mount the Shiploader onto. One of the challenges of moving the Shiploader is the height of which it must be moved at. We are moving it 12' in the air as a result of structural extensions hanging below the main girders This puts our center of gravity close to 18' in the air, making it critical that we keep it level during the moving process. |
